How Mental Health Benefits Work
Many group insurance plans are required by law to cover mental health benefits at the same level as physical health services. This indicates that family therapy appointments will often be included just like a visit with your primary care doctor. That said, the specific degree of benefit differs based on your specific plan, provider, and where you are in your deductible.
Before you start https://pastelink.net/lbvqufdo booking your first family therapy visit at Eye Cue Mental Health, it's a good idea to contact your insurance carrier first and inquire the right questions. Find out whether family therapy is included under your mental health benefits, what your out-of-pocket cost is per session, and whether you need a doctor's order prior to initiating care.

Understanding Your Insurance Out-of-Pocket Cost
An insurance copay is the set amount you pay at each therapy visit after your deductible is fulfilled. For family therapy, cost-sharing amounts usually range somewhere between a modest amount per appointment, although this depends considerably by plan. Being clear on your precise copay upfront allows your family plan more effectively.

Out-of-Network Benefits Explained
Not every family therapist works with every insurance plan, and this is perfectly understandable. If Eye Cue Mental Health is listed as out-of-network for your insurer, you can often be qualified for out-of-network reimbursement. This means you cover the session fee directly, and then send in a reimbursement request to your insurance company for partial expense.
